Amanda Anisimova’s Inspiring Comeback Story

For many fans, 2025 marks the year Amanda Anisimova truly came full circle. After taking a mental health break from professional tennis in 2023, the young American made a gradual return in 2024, focusing on rebuilding her game and her mindset.

That patience has paid off spectacularly this year. With a series of strong performances on both the WTA Tour and in Grand Slam events, Anisimova has climbed back into the world’s top 10 rankings. Her comeback has been defined by determination, resilience, and a renewed love for the sport she started playing as a child.

“Taking time away was one of the best decisions I made,” Anisimova shared earlier this year in an interview. “It allowed me to rediscover why I love tennis and why I started in the first place.”


Breakthrough Performances in 2025

Amanda Anisimova’s 2025 season has been nothing short of outstanding. The year has seen her deliver multiple deep runs in major tournaments, including:

  • A Wimbledon Final Appearance: Despite falling short against world No. 1 Iga Świątek, Anisimova’s run to the final was one of the tournament’s biggest stories. Her aggressive baseline play and calm composure impressed fans and critics alike.
  • A US Open Final: Playing in front of a home crowd in New York, Anisimova powered through a stacked draw to reach the final, defeating top names including Naomi Osaka and Coco Gauff along the way.
  • WTA 1000 Success: She claimed her biggest career title at the China Open, defeating Gauff once again in the semifinals and securing the trophy with commanding performances throughout the week.
  • Consistent Top-10 Wins: Anisimova has defeated every Grand Slam champion currently active on the tour this year, proving her ability to compete with the very best.

These milestones not only solidify her status as one of the most dangerous players on the WTA circuit but also signal a possible new era of dominance for American women’s tennis.


The Playing Style That Defines Amanda Anisimova

Amanda Anisimova’s game is built on precision, power, and poise. Known for her fluid groundstrokes and ability to dictate rallies, her style combines classic shot-making with modern athleticism.

Her biggest strengths include:

  • Explosive baseline power: She can hit winners off both wings with minimal effort.
  • Reliable serve: Improved placement and variation have made her service games more secure this year.
  • Court awareness: Her shot selection has matured, balancing aggression with strategic patience.
  • Composure under pressure: One of her key improvements in 2025 has been her mental resilience during tight matches.

On grass and hard courts, in particular, Anisimova’s aggressive style thrives — a big reason behind her deep runs in both Wimbledon and the US Open this year.


The Mental Game: From Setback to Strength

Anisimova’s mental transformation has been just as crucial as her technical progress. Once known to lose focus in long matches, she now exudes confidence and maturity on court.

Her mental health break in 2023 was a turning point. After years of early success, personal loss, and relentless pressure, she chose to prioritize well-being over competition. That decision allowed her to reset and return stronger than ever.

In 2025, her demeanor on court shows that she has embraced balance — competing fiercely without letting the sport consume her. “I play for myself now, not for expectations,” she said in a recent press conference. “That’s what makes every win so meaningful.”
